Jerome Sylvester Fenwick, 61, of Chaptico, MD died April 7, 2008 at his home.

Born October 7, 1946 in Chaptico, MD, he was the son of Lillian Theresa Mills Fenwick and the late James Earl Fenwick.

Jerome was educated in the St. Mary's County Public Schools System. He graduated in 1964 from Banneker High School. In addition to his regular classes, he took a shop class in brick masonry which led to his career in the masonry field. To advance his knowledge in this field, he took more classes in the drawing and reading of blue prints at McKinley Tech Vocation School in Washington, DC. After working several years at other construction jobs, he began his own company in 1970 known as Fenwick's Masonry. He continued to operate his business until his illness in July of 2007. Jerome was an original member of the minority alliance, a black business organization in St. Mary's County, and served one term as it's president. His priorities in life were in this order; God, faith and family. He was a man of character, integrity and convictions. He was always there for his family. Until he became too tired and weak to walk, he visited his mother every day. His hobbies were drawing, painting and playing the guitar. He was a member of the Our Lady of the Wayside Church in Chaptico, MD.
